Bargaining Unit and Ratification Policy Update
The Local 47 Executive Board approved amendments to the Bargaining Unit and Ratification Policy on July 19, 2016, in accordance with the Electronic Voting Resolution passed at the 2016 AFM Convention.
The policy may be found in the members section of the Local 47 website at afm47.org (login required), or from the Secretary’s Office.

Our Story, Our Legacy: BlackMusic, BlackWork exhibit to celebrate the rich legacy of Los Angeles Local 767

Workers and supporters of the Los Angeles Black Worker Center and former members and family of the historical L.A. musicians union Local 767 join together at the BlackMusic, BlackWork kickoff fundraising event, which took place at the Vision Theatre in Liemert Park July 21. (Photo: Linda A. Rapka)
The richness of Los Angeles comprises stories that move the mind, soul, and conviction. One of these stories is the unsung bravery and artistry of early Central Avenue musicians whose work transformed L.A.’s music industry forever.
BlackMusic, BlackWork, an upcoming historical exhibit of the Los Angeles Black musicians union Local 767, aims to share dynamic history of organizing in the arts that spans the founding of the city’s Black musicians union in the 1920s to the contemporary struggles of working musicians who understand the transformative power of art and culture.

Artifacts from the historical Los Angeles Black musicians union Local 767 from the 1920s through the 1950s.
In a major kickoff event to raise funds for this historic exhibition set to debut in February 2017 during Black History Month, AFM Local 47, the Los Angeles Black Worker Center, UCLA Labor Center, and the City of Los Angeles hosted the Jam Session for Justice in the Arts Fundraiser at the Vision Theatre in Liemert Park on July 21.

Stronger Together: Why it Pays to Work Union
As an AFM member, you shape your future through participation in the decision-making process at local and national levels. When you work under AFM contracts, employers make contributions toward your retirement fund. When you meet eligible earnings thresholds, you and your dependents have access to health and life insurance. Continue reading
